Transaction 004640733ee5116c8261c86b19d94dab7409245b95976edc3e148987e6e795fc
1 Input
2 Outputs
- 004640733ee5116c8261c86b19d94dab7409245b95976edc3e148987e6e795fc:0
- 004640733ee5116c8261c86b19d94dab7409245b95976edc3e148987e6e795fc:1
value 1774146
address 1HueqJcrP5PvuBwxHLafJCFYkguXosoFp6
value 497189648
address 15wMANwvqxaZyg1nhBALuJb2CVm2FxdPiT